What Are Decorative Switch Plates?
A decorative switch plate is a cover for a light switch or electrical outlet that goes beyond basic white plastic. These plates are made from materials like ceramic, wood, leather, or metal, and they often feature hand-painted designs, sculptural details, or natural textures. Unlike standard switch covers, decorative switch plates are designed to be seen—they become part of the wall decor rather than something to hide. In a bedroom, they can tie together a color palette, echo a motif from your artwork, or add a subtle artisanal accent.
Why Choose Handcrafted Switch Plates Over Standard Ones?
Mass-produced switch plates are uniform and anonymous. Handcrafted switch plates, by contrast, are one-of-a-kind. Each one carries the fingerprint of the maker—brush strokes, glaze variations, the slight irregularities of hand-thrown clay. These imperfections are not flaws; they are evidence of human labor. When you install a handcrafted switch plate, you bring a piece of the maker’s story into your bedroom. Materials matter, too: ceramic keeps the wall cool and tactile; wood adds warmth; leather ages gracefully. Handcrafted plates also tend to be made in small batches, often using locally sourced materials, which supports small-scale artisans and reduces the environmental impact of long-distance shipping and plastic production.
How Do I Coordinate Switch Plates with My Bedroom Wall Decor?
The key is to treat the switch plate as part of the composition, not an afterthought. Here are three cohesive bedroom wall decor systems that incorporate decorative switch plates:
- Above-Headboard Art + Coordinated Switch Plate: Hang a large, handcrafted wall hanging or a triptych above the headboard. Choose a switch plate that echoes a color or texture from the art. For example, if your wall art features terracotta tones, a ceramic switch plate with a similar glaze creates a seamless flow.
- Gallery Row with Integrated Switch Plate: When arranging a gallery wall of smaller pieces, plan the layout so that the switch plate becomes part of the grid. Mount a decorative plate near the light switch, and frame it with complementary artworks. The plate becomes a functional element that also acts as a mini panel in the display.
- Accent Wall with a Statement Switch Plate: On a painted or wallpapered accent wall, let the switch plate stand out. A hand-painted ceramic plate with a bold pattern can serve as a focal point, while the surrounding wall decor—perhaps a few floating shelves with handcrafted objects—plays a supporting role.
Regardless of the system, aim for a cohesive material language. If your room features ceramic vases or leather goods, extend that material to the switch plate for a unified, tactile experience.

How Do I Install a Decorative Switch Plate?
Installing a handcrafted switch plate is straightforward. First, turn off power to the switch at the circuit breaker for safety. Remove the existing plate by unscrewing the mounting screws. Align the new decorative plate over the switch, ensuring the toggle or rocker openings match. Use the provided screws—often brass or decorative to match the plate—to secure it gently. Do not overtighten, especially with ceramic or wood, to avoid cracking. Once installed, restore power and enjoy the transformation. The entire process takes less than five minutes.
Can I Create a Gallery Wall Around a Switch Plate?
Absolutely. In fact, a gallery wall that incorporates a switch plate can feel more dynamic and lived-in. Start by positioning the switch plate as an anchor point. Then, arrange framed prints, small woven hangings, or ceramic wall tiles around it, leaving about 2–3 inches of space between pieces. Mix sizes and orientations, but keep a consistent color thread. The switch plate becomes a functional piece of art that anchors the arrangement. Do decorative switch plates fit standard outlets?
Yes, most handcrafted switch plates are designed to fit standard single-gang or double-gang switch boxes. Always check the listing for dimensions, but SVZQ pieces are made to North American standards.
Are ceramic switch plates fragile?
High-fired ceramic is durable and resistant to everyday bumps. However, like any ceramic object, it can break if dropped or struck hard. Proper installation with gentle screw tightening prevents most issues.
Can I use a decorative switch plate in a bathroom?
While ceramic and wood plates can be used in bathrooms, they should be placed away from direct water spray. For humid areas, choose a glazed ceramic plate; avoid unsealed wood. Always follow local electrical code.
How do I clean a handcrafted leather switch plate?
Use a slightly damp cloth to remove dust, and occasionally condition with a natural leather balm. Avoid alcohol-based cleaners, which can dry out the leather.
